Both buggies are the same size. The LX Pro is an Older Ofna design and the technology is kind of dated. The PBS and the Violator both take advantage of "todays" technology. The Violator is a C-hub design with a big block .26 while the PBS has the Pivot Ball suspension with a .21 in it. The PBS is more of a recer while the Violator is a basher.
